Job Requirements
- Must be at least 21 years of age
- Must obtain and maintain a New Mexico Alcohol Server's License upon hire
- Must successfully pass a stringent background investigation
- Will require pre-employment and random drug screening
- Ability to lift at least 25 lbs
- Ability to perform physical activities such as balancing, climbing, crawling, crouching, finger dexterity, grasping, hearing, kneeling, lifting, pulling, pushing, reaching, seeing, walking, sitting, standing, stooping, and talking
- Availability to work days, nights, weekends, holidays, split shifts, and overtime
- Punctual and regular attendance
- Ability to maintain a safe work environment for oneself and others
- Must adhere to health and safety guidelines including sanitation
- Ability to provide exceptional customer service under pressure

Job Duties
- Greets guests with a friendly and welcoming demeanor
- Takes and accurately records drink orders into the Point-Of-Sale system
- Maintains a professional and approachable attitude
- Monitors and intervenes service to guests who appear intoxicated
- Sets up the cocktail area at beginning of shift and breaks down at closing
- Participates in daily stand-up meetings
- Collects orders from bartender and serves to guests
- Supports a positive and inclusive work environment
- Collaborates with team members to ensure seamless service
- Maintains knowledge of in-house services and local information
- Maintains cleanliness of tables and removes empty glassware
- Identifies opportunities to upsell beverages
- Uses guest names appropriately
- Adheres to uniform standards
- Complies with health and safety guidelines
- Processes guest payments accurately
- Completes opening and closing side work
- Ensures responsible alcohol service including ID checks
- Serves food as required
- Operates POS system and maintains financial integrity
- Maintains punctuality and regular attendance
